45 * Retrieve the state of a CPU:
46 * online: CPU is in a normal run state
47 * possible: CPU is a candidate to be made online
48 * available: CPU is candidate for the 'possible' pool
50 #define cpu_possible(cpu) paca[cpu].active
51 #define cpu_available(cpu) paca[cpu].available

66 /* Since OpenPIC has only 4 IPIs, we use slightly different message numbers.
68 * Make sure this matches openpic_request_IPIs in open_pic.c, or what shows up
69 * in /proc/interrupts will be wrong!!! --Troy */
70 #define PPC_MSG_CALL_FUNCTION 0
71 #define PPC_MSG_RESCHEDULE 1
72 #define PPC_MSG_INVALIDATE_TLB 2
73 #define PPC_MSG_XMON_BREAK 3
